    No one will give you a deal with those specs and your budget here is why :

    1. Standard Windows License is $20 - $25 a month

    2. 100 GB HD is too low for a Datacenter to put in as they dont make any money off it.

    3. 3 GB of ram will not happen.

    4. 2 TB could get that .

    5. 100mbps is high for a low - end server, most likely come in a 10mbps lot.

    My suggestion is buy a pre-made dedicated server from soft layer or a US datacenter.
